Crime & Justice

Sheriff Finally Quits After ‘Black Bastards’ Scandal—but Won’t Stop Fighting for Re-Election

‘PRESERVE OUR FREEDOM’

Suspended North Carolina Sheriff Jody Greene resigned before a judge could remove him this week but refuses to give up his re-election campaign.

Screen_Shot_2022-10-25_at_1.38.28_PM_j4wn3r
Facebook